How much do lab processing jobs pay per hour?

As of May 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for lab processing in Indiana is $21.44,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.40 and $23.12 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Lab Processing Technician,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Lab Processing Technician, you need a solid understanding of laboratory procedures, specimen handling, and safety protocols, often supported by a high school diploma or associate’s degree in a science-related field. Familiarity with laboratory information management systems (LIMS), centrifuges, and sample tracking software is typically required. Attention to detail, organization, and strong communication skills help ensure accuracy and effective teamwork. These skills are essential for maintaining sample integrity, minimizing errors, and supporting efficient lab operations.

What are some of the most common challenges faced in a Lab Processing role, and how can they be managed?

One of the most common challenges in Lab Processing is managing a high volume of specimens while maintaining accuracy and meeting strict turnaround times. This requires strong organizational skills and attention to detail, as even small errors can impact test results. Teamwork is essential, since lab processors often collaborate with technicians, pathologists, and administrative staff to ensure samples are handled and documented correctly. Adapting to new technologies and evolving protocols is also important for ongoing success in this field.

What is lab processing?

Lab processing refers to the series of procedures performed in a laboratory to prepare and analyze biological samples, such as blood, tissue, or urine. This typically involves receiving specimens, labeling, centrifugation, separation, and storage or preparation for testing. Lab processing ensures samples are handled correctly to maintain their integrity for accurate diagnostic results. Proper lab processing is essential for reliable clinical testing and patient care.

Job description

We are seeking a self-motivated Lab Technician to join our Laboratory Operations team. In this role you will be preparing batches of samples by receiving and sorting the urine and oral fluid specimens at your assigned work station. The Lab Technician is responsible for reading and scanning the chain of custody forms, ordering applicable tests in the system and applying barcoded labels ensuring samples are ready for the testing process.

Shift: M-F 12pm-8:30pm We are hiring for various shifts and will be discussed during the interview process.

Salary: $16.50

Shift Differential: Additional $2.00/hr for time worked between 6:00 PM to 6:00 AM

Primary Responsibilities

  • Performs routine operations including the opening of sample bags, creating accessions and batches, orders proper test(s), applies bar code labels.
  • Scans Chain of Custody (CoC) forms, ensuring proper orientation and reproducible documents.
  • Determines if proper aliquot achieved; may be required to hand pour aliquots using bulb pipettes.
  • Separates out samples that require additional attention.
  • Keys in client and donor information noting any deficiencies after being signed off for the operation by the Team Lead
  • May perform additional duties including transporting batches to other departments, placing or pulling samples from freezer storage, while assuring proper chain of custody.
  • Follows all laboratory policies and procedures; adheres to all health and safety standards
  • All other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or equivalent, required
  • Experience working in a lab or high-volume production environment, preferred.
  • Ability to interpret and follow complex, written instructions, required.
  • Strong attention to detail, required
  • Ability to work independently as well as the ability to communicate effectively in a team environment, required.
  • Data entry skills via a keyboard (alpha and numeric), required
  • Strong hand-eye coordination, required.
  • Physical demands required to perform critical tasks in this role include standing for long periods of time, lifting up to 25lbs, bending and carrying.
